Cleaning and Maintenance

The first step in properly storing your sports equipment is to make sure it is clean and well maintained This applies to any type of equipment, from bicycles to kayaks, from surfing equipment to wetsuits. After the last use of the season, clean your equipment thoroughly to remove dirt, sand, salt or any other residue. Also check for damaged or worn parts that need repair or replacement. Good maintenance not only extends the life of your equipment but also ensures that it is ready for use as soon as the next season arrives.

How to store

Once your equipment is clean and in good condition, it’s time to think about how to store it The general rule of thumb is to avoid places that are damp, cold or exposed to direct sunlight. These factors can damage your equipment over time, causing corrosion, mold or fading of colors. Instead, try to find a dry, cool and dark place to store your equipment. Organization

When it comes to storing sports equipment, organization is key Try to group similar items together and use containers or boxes to protect smaller or delicate items. If you are using temporary storage, consider creating an inventory of your equipment. This will help you keep track of what you have stored and easily find what you need.
